Mesh Класс

Определение

Класс, представляющий объект сетки.

[Android.Runtime.Register("android/graphics/Mesh", ApiSince=34, DoNotGenerateAcw=true)]
public class Mesh : Java.Lang.Object
[<Android.Runtime.Register("android/graphics/Mesh", ApiSince=34, DoNotGenerateAcw=true)>]
type Mesh = class
    inherit Object
Наследование
Mesh
Атрибуты

Комментарии

Класс, представляющий объект сетки.

Этот класс представляет объект Mesh, который при необходимости можно индексировать. Требуется MeshSpecification вместе с различными атрибутами для детализации объекта сетки, включая режим, буфер вершин, необязательный буфер индекса и границы для сетки. После создания объект сетки можно прорисовать через Canvas#drawMesh(Mesh, BlendMode, Paint)

Документация по Java для android.graphics.Mesh.

Части этой страницы являются изменениями, основанными на работе, созданной и совместно используемой проектом Android и используемой в соответствии с условиями, Creative Commons 2.5 Attribution License.

Конструкторы

Mesh(IntPtr, JniHandleOwnership)

Класс, представляющий объект сетки.

Mesh(MeshSpecification, MeshType, Buffer, Int32, RectF)

Конструктор для неиндексированного сетки.

Mesh(MeshSpecification, MeshType, Buffer, Int32, ShortBuffer, RectF)

Конструктор индексированного сетки.

Поля

Triangles
Устаревшие..

Сетка будет нарисована треугольниками без использования общих вершин.

TriangleStrip
Устаревшие..

Сетка будет нарисована треугольниками, использующими общие вершины.

Свойства

Class

Возвращает класс среды выполнения данного объекта Object.

(Унаследовано от Object)
Handle

Дескриптор базового экземпляра Android.

(Унаследовано от Object)
JniIdentityHashCode

Класс, представляющий объект сетки.

(Унаследовано от Object)
JniPeerMembers

Класс, представляющий объект сетки.

PeerReference

Класс, представляющий объект сетки.

(Унаследовано от Object)
ThresholdClass

Класс, представляющий объект сетки.

ThresholdType

Класс, представляющий объект сетки.

Методы

Clone()

Создает и возвращает копию этого объекта.

(Унаследовано от Object)
Dispose()

Класс, представляющий объект сетки.

(Унаследовано от Object)
Dispose(Boolean)

Класс, представляющий объект сетки.

(Унаследовано от Object)
Equals(Object)

Указывает, равен ли какой-то другой объект этому объекту.

(Унаследовано от Object)
GetHashCode()

Возвращает значение хэш-кода для объекта.

(Унаследовано от Object)
JavaFinalize()

Вызывается сборщиком мусора для объекта , когда сборка мусора определяет, что больше нет ссылок на объект .

(Унаследовано от Object)
Notify()

Пробуждает один поток, ожидающий монитора этого объекта.

(Унаследовано от Object)
NotifyAll()

Пробуждает все потоки, ожидающие на мониторе этого объекта.

(Унаследовано от Object)
SetColorUniform(String, Color)

Задает равномерное значение цвета, соответствующее шейдеру, назначенному сетке.

SetColorUniform(String, ColorObject)

Задает равномерное значение цвета, соответствующее шейдеру, назначенному сетке.

SetColorUniform(String, Int64)

Задает равномерное значение цвета, соответствующее шейдеру, назначенному сетке.

SetFloatUniform(String, Single)

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

SetFloatUniform(String, Single, Single)

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

SetFloatUniform(String, Single, Single, Single)

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

SetFloatUniform(String, Single, Single, Single, Single)

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

SetFloatUniform(String, Single[])

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

SetHandle(IntPtr, JniHandleOwnership)

Задает свойство Handle.

(Унаследовано от Object)
SetIntUniform(String, Int32)

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

SetIntUniform(String, Int32, Int32)

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

SetIntUniform(String, Int32, Int32, Int32)

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

SetIntUniform(String, Int32, Int32, Int32, Int32)

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

SetIntUniform(String, Int32[])

Задает универсальное значение, соответствующее шейдеру, назначенному сетке.

ToArray<T>()

Класс, представляющий объект сетки.

(Унаследовано от Object)
ToString()

Возвращает строковое представление объекта.

(Унаследовано от Object)
UnregisterFromRuntime()

Класс, представляющий объект сетки.

(Унаследовано от Object)
Wait()

Вызывает ожидание текущего потока, пока он не пробудится, как правило, из-за <уведомления><<> или>прерывания или прерывания.><

(Унаследовано от Object)
Wait(Int64)

Вызывает ожидание текущего потока, пока он не пробудится, как правило, путем <уведомления><<> или>прерывания или прерывания<> или до истечения определенного количества реального времени.

(Унаследовано от Object)
Wait(Int64, Int32)

Вызывает ожидание текущего потока, пока он не пробудится, как правило, путем <уведомления><<> или>прерывания или прерывания<> или до истечения определенного количества реального времени.

(Унаследовано от Object)

Явные реализации интерфейса

IJavaPeerable.Disposed()

Класс, представляющий объект сетки.

(Унаследовано от Object)
IJavaPeerable.DisposeUnlessReferenced()

Класс, представляющий объект сетки.

(Унаследовано от Object)
IJavaPeerable.Finalized()

Класс, представляющий объект сетки.

(Унаследовано от Object)
IJavaPeerable.JniManagedPeerState

Класс, представляющий объект сетки.

(Унаследовано от Object)
IJavaPeerable.SetJniIdentityHashCode(Int32)

Класс, представляющий объект сетки.

(Унаследовано от Object)
IJavaPeerable.SetJniManagedPeerState(JniManagedPeerStates)

Класс, представляющий объект сетки.

(Унаследовано от Object)
IJavaPeerable.SetPeerReference(JniObjectReference)

Класс, представляющий объект сетки.

(Унаследовано от Object)

Методы расширения

JavaCast<TResult>(IJavaObject)

Выполняет преобразование типа, проверенного средой выполнения Android.

JavaCast<TResult>(IJavaObject)

Класс, представляющий объект сетки.

GetJniTypeName(IJavaPeerable)

Класс, представляющий объект сетки.

Применяется к